Here's another little something to watch for, and it literally just hit me a few minutes ago. It didn't stand out on either viewing, because it's some damned clever filmmaking.
When Royalton is talking about the '43 Grand Prix, and it shows the old black and white pictures of Ben Burns in victory lane, drinking milk, I think they superimposed an old picture of Richard Roundtree's head from one of the Shaft movies. If not from the movie, definitely from the same time period. He's got the 'fro and the big moustache.
It didn't stand out to me because I knew it was Richard Roundtree, and I knew present-day Ben Burns was also Richard Roundtree. It only just clicked with me that Roundtree doesn't look at all like Shaft anymore. (Hell, he looks more like Benson!)
And it would also explain why they used still pics for that bit instead of old B&W race footage, as they did elsewhere.
That is a brilliant use of digital manipulation there.

I saw this at the $1.50 theater and I thought it was pretty darn good, considering the source material. The final race seemed tacked on, and when you are over 2 hours in a kid's movie you are boiling over into unforgivable territory, but the movie gives it a go on plot and collapses in on itself with flashbacks like the bowtie twists and turns of the tracks when it could have very easily played it safe and succeeded almost exclusively on a visual level.
And what a look! I thought the coruscant night chase had brilliant color, but the palette here is completely off the charts. i can't wait to see it on my plasma.
If the movie is a failure, this is not the failure of a hack. This one is going to live on in the annals of cult films, much like Flash Gordon, another camp classic.
